The city of Swaledale is located in the state of Iowa in Cerro Gordo County and has a population of 166 as reported by the census of 2010. Swaledale, Iowa Climate and Weather
Current Weather in Swaledale
In the month of December, Swaledale experiences an average high temperature of 27 degrees Fahrenheit. Low temperaturs in December are usually about 11 degrees with an average rainfall of 1.08 inches. The seasonal climate varies in Swaledale with daytime temperatures averaging 79 degrees in the summer, and 26 degrees in the winter months. Visitors can also expect Swaledale to receive an average of 0.99 inches of rainfall per/month during winter months and 4.05 inches of rainfall per/month in the summer months. The temperature has been known to get as high as 104 degrees in the summer and as low as -32 degrees in the winter so visitors planning a vacation to Swaledale should check the weather forecast to determine proper attire prior to departure. Stockman House - Mason City, The Dr. G.C. Stockman House, which is also referred to as Mrs. Evangeline Skarlis House, was designed by Frank Lloyd Wright and built in 1908 for Dr. George C. and Eleanor Stockman in Mason City, Iowa. The home was originally located at 311 1st St. SE, but was moved to 530 1st St. NE to evade demolition. It has been fully restored as a public museum and is listed on the National Register of Historic Places.
